RALEIGH, N.C. — A man has been charged in connection with a fatal stabbing that occurred Saturday night, authorities said.

Steve Andrew Garcia, 17, was charged with murder following the stabbing death of Jonathan Maurice Culbreth, 21. He was being held Sunday without bond at the Wake County Jail.

Garcia was expected to appear in court on Tuesday for a preliminary hearing.

There were two crime scenes, including where the incident occurred, which was in the 3900 block of Dowling Haven Place shortly before 7 p.m.

Culbreth was rushed to WakeMed for treatment, where he died.

WRAL reporter Kasey Cunningham saw a man being taken into custody at a location a short distance from where the stabbing occurred but it was not immediately clear if that man was involved in the stabbing.

Residents who live on Dowling Haven Place said they didn't know much about the incident and had few details about the victim.

On Sunday, Garcia was being held in the Wake County Detention Center.

Police said anyone with information was asked to call investigators.
